Output 664e70951cf798d6eec6d826ffe923cd5113594d79583ade1c1384e1bf665f4b:0

value
97943192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ec6560f01e1c80d438c721fb1d678f4f3865c91 OP_EQUALVERIFY OP_CHECKSIG
address
LTs5NtCPLef3iy9uhCVh33kMfDUA4kXvhi
transaction
664e70951cf798d6eec6d826ffe923cd5113594d79583ade1c1384e1bf665f4b
spent
true